SUMMARY OF PRODUCT CHARACTERISTICS 1 NAME OF THE MEDICINAL PRODUCT Nicotinell Fruity Mint 1 mg compressed lozenge 2 QUALITATIVE AND QUANTITATIVE COMPOSITION Each piece of lozenge contains: Active substance: 1 mg nicotine (corresponding to 3.072 mg nicotine bitartrate dihydrate). Excipient(s) with known effect: aspartame (0.01 g), maltitol (0.9 g), sulphites (0.00005 mg) and sodium (9.8 mg). For the full list of excipients, see section 6.1. 3 PHARMACEUTICAL FORM Compressed lozenge White, fruit-mint flavoured, round biconvex lozenge 4 CLINICAL PARTICULARS 4.1 THERAPEUTIC INDICATIONS Nicotinell Fruity Mint is indicated in adults. Treatment of tobacco dependence by providing relief of nicotine withdrawal symptoms including cravings (see section 5.1), thereby facilitating smoking cessation or temporary smoking reduction in smokers motivated to quit smoking. Permanent cessation of tobacco use is the eventual objective. Patient counselling and support normally improve the success rate. 4.2 POSOLOGY AND METHOD OF ADMINISTRATION Nicotinell Fruity Mint lozenge 1 mg may be used alone or in combination with Nicotinell transdermal patch. PAEDIATRIC POPULATION Nicotinell Fruity Mint could only be used in adolescents (aged 12-17 years) with advice and medical supervision from a physician. Nicotinell Fruity Mint is not recommended for use in children under 12 years of age. The safety and efficacy of Nicotinell Fruity Mint in children under 12 years of age have not been established. No data are available. ADULTS AND ELDERLY POSOLOGY: TREATMENT WITH NICOTINELL LOZENGES ONLY Nicotinell Fruity Mint 1 mg lozenge is recommended in smokers with a low to moderate nicotine dependency.
